Title
Letter from the Lord Chancellor to the Duke of Clarence, regarding a living he has requested
Date
22 April 1806
Writer
Erskine,Thomas, 1st Baron; Lord Chancellor
Addressee
Clarence and St Andrews, William, Duke of
Description
The Lord Chancellor informs William that the living he has asked for was given away by Lord Eldon [John Scott, 1st Earl of Eldon].
